                            | Here is a list of diseases for which stem cell treatment has been used: |  
                            | Acute Leukemias Acute Biphenotypic Leukemia
 Acute Lymphocytic Leukemia (ALL)
 Acute Myelogenous Leukemia (AML)
 Acute Undifferentiated Leukemia
 
 
 
                                    Chronic LeukemiasChronic Lymphocytic Leukemia (CLL)
 Chronic Myelogenous Leukemia (CML)
 Juvenile Chronic Myelogenous Leukemia (JCML)
 Juvenile Myelomonocytic Leukemia (JMML)
 
                                    Myelodysplastic SyndromesAmyloidosis
 Chronic Myelomonocytic Leukemia (CMML)
 Refractory Anemia (RA)
 Refractory Anemia with Excess Blasts (RAEB)
 Refractory Anemia with Excess Blasts in Transformation (RAEB-T)
 Refractory Anemia with Ringed Sideroblasts (RARS)
 
                                    Stem Cell DisordersAplastic Anemia (Severe)
 Congenital Cytopenia
 Dyskeratosis Congenita
 Fanconi Anemia
 Paroxysmal Nocturnal Hemoglobinuria (PNH)
 
                                    Myeloproliferative DisordersAcute Myelofibrosis
 Agnogenic Myeloid Metaplasia (Myelofibrosis)
 Essential Thrombocythemia
 Polycythemia Vera
 
 Lymphoproliferative Disorders
 Hodgkin's Disease
 Non-Hodgkin's Lymphoma
 Prolymphocytic Leukemia

                                    Liposomal Storage DiseasesAdrenoleukodystrophy
 Alpha Mannosidosis
 Gaucher's Disease
 Hunter's Syndrome (MPS-II)
 Hurler's Syndrome (MPS-IH)
 Krabbe Disease
 Maroteaux-Lamy Syndrome (MPS-VI)
 Metachromatic Leukodystrophy
 Morquio Syndrome (MPS-IV)
 Mucolipidosis II (I-cell Disease)
 Mucopolysaccharidoses (MPS)
 Niemann-Pick Disease
 Sanfilippo Syndrome (MPS-III)
 Scheie Syndrome (MPS-IS)
 Sly Syndrome, Beta-Glucuronidase Deficiency (MPS-VII)
 Wolman Disease
 
                                    Histiocytic DisordersFamilial Erythrophagocytic Lymphohistiocytosis
 Hemophagocytosis
 Histiocytosis-X
 Langerhans' Cell Histiocytosis
 
                                    Inherited Erythrocyte AbnormalitiesBeta Thalassemia Major
 Blackfan-Diamond Anemia
 Pure Red Cell Aplasia
 Sickle Cell Disease
 
 Congenital (Inherited) Immune System Disorders
 Absence of T and B Cells SCID
 Absence of T Cells, Normal B Cell SCID
 Ataxia-Telangiectasia
 Bare Lymphocyte Syndrome
 Common Variable Immunodeficiency
 DiGeorge Syndrome
 Kostmann Syndrome
 Leukocyte Adhesion Deficiency
 Omenn's Syndrome
 Severe Combined Immunodeficiency (SCID)
 SCID with Adenosine Deaminase Deficiency
 Wiskott-Aldrich Syndrome
 X-Linked Lymphoproliferative Disorder

                                    Other Inherited DisordersCartilage-Hair Hypoplasia
 Ceroid Lipofuscinosis
 Congenital Erythropoietic Porphyria
 Glanzmann Thrombasthenia
 Lesch-Nyhan Syndrome
 Osteopetrosis
 Sandhoff Disease
 
                                    Inherited Platelet AbnormalitiesAmegakaryocytosis / Congenital Thrombocytopenia
 
                                    Plasma Cell DisordersMultiple Myeloma
 Plasma Cell Leukemia
 Waldenstrom's Macroglobulinemia
 
                                    Other MalignanciesBrain Tumors
 Ewing Sarcoma
 Neuroblastoma
 Ovarian Cancer
 Renal Cell Carcinoma
 Small-Cell Lung Cancer
 Testicular Cancer
 
                                    Autoimmune DiseasesMultiple Sclerosis (experimental)
 Rheumatoid Arthritis (experimental)
 Systemic Lupus Erythematosus (experimental)
 
                                    Emerging Stem Cell Applications*Alzheimer's Disease
 Diabetes
 Heart Disease
 Liver Disease
 Muscular Dystrophy
 Parkinson's Disease
 Spinal Cord Injury
 Stroke
 
 Phagocyte Disorders
 Chediak-Higashi Syndrome
 Chronic Granulomatous Disease
 Neutrophil Actin Deficiency
 Reticular Dysgenesis
